Bug Description
Both the Signing and the SSL tests depend on X509 certificates. These certificates have been geenrated by hand and checked in. Instead, the command lines executed to generate the repos should be recorded, so that the certificates can be regernereated. This has already caused a problem with the SSL unit tests failing. Additionally, it documents to end users the steps they need to generate their own certificates.
